Lockdown lessons: Violence and policing in a pandemic
This report by the Institute for Security Studies (ISS) and the Western Cape Government examines the impact of South Africa's 2020 COVID-19 lockdown on violence and policing, specifically focusing on 11 police areas in Cape Town. Using murder data, interviews, and a survey of over 5,000 residents, the study identifies a strong correlation between alcohol bans and the reduction of sharp-object murders and fatal violence against women, while finding that firearm-related murders remained largely unaffected by lockdown restrictions.
